The average bus between Tring and Knightsbridge takes 3h 5m and the fastest bus takes 2h 44m. The bus service runs several times per day from Tring to Knightsbridge.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Buses run every 4 hours between Tring and Knightsbridge. The earliest departure is at 6:20 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Tring is at 6:05 PM which arrives into Knightsbridge at 8:55 PM. All services require a transfer at Church Street and take an average of 3h 5m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ct bus from Tring to Knightsbridge. However, there are services departing from Tring station and arriving at Knightsbridge station via Church Street.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 5m.
Tring to Knightsbridge bus services, operated by Red Eagle, depart from Church Square station.
Tring to Knightsbridge bus services, operated by Red Eagle, arrive at Hyde Park Corner station.
The distance between Tring and Knightsbridge is 47.2 km. The road distance is 97 km.
You can take a bus from Church Square to Hyde Park Corner via Church Street and Luton Station Interchange in around 2h 43m.
